Output 170ffe29aab142956e7dd9a6669783a014c94529d104779f086a864e02fe23bf:177

value
150475
script pubkey
OP_0 OP_PUSHBYTES_20 e8a110a4f727b58b7663a8db84a078e1fe2f4b30
address
bc1qazs3pf8hy76ckanr4rdcfgrcu8lz7jes3yjf2f
transaction
170ffe29aab142956e7dd9a6669783a014c94529d104779f086a864e02fe23bf